People v. Simmons

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department
Feb 8, 1999
258 A.D.2d 538 (N.Y. App. Div. 1999)

Opinion

February 8, 1999

Writ of error coram nobis.


Ordered that the application is denied.

The appellant has failed to establish that she was denied the effective assistance of appellate counsel ( see, Jones v. Barnes, 463 U.S. 745).

Bracken, J. P., Miller, Ritter and Goldstein, JJ., concur.
